The pyramids were the tombs of the Egyptians kings, queens and their households. They were constructed under the command of the King while he reigned over Egypt. The geometry of these wonders were well advanced, as shown in the ancient Moscow and Rhind Mathematical Papyri.
The Moscow Mathematical Papyrus dates to the twelfth dynasty of Egypt. Seven of the Twenty-five problems in the papyrus are geometry problems. The problems range from finding the surface of a hemisphere, computing areas of triangles, to find the volume of a frustum (or truncated pyramid). This papyrus alone tells us that the Egyptians were well adept in using math and geometry. It clearly shows us how they were able to build such structures like the pyramids.

Phi (1.618), also known as The Golden Ratio, is found by dividing a line into two segments so that the longer part divided by the smaller part is also equal to the whole length divided by the longer part. It is the only number that's square is one more than itself. Pi (3.14) is the ratio of a circle's circumference to its diameter.
